A Hootsuite Case Study
The Rockefeller Foundation, a century-old global philanthropic organization, needed to do more than broaden its reach — it had to influence the people and institutions with the power to drive change. Facing the challenge of turning awareness into action for initiatives like the 100 Resilient Cities campaign, the foundation sought ways to engage policymakers, partners, and the public beyond its immediate network.
Using Hootsuite, the digital team identified and trained internal social champions, created listening streams and influencer lists, and pursued one‑to‑one outreach to key external voices. The approach converted high-profile supporters into brand champions (an Elton John post reached 190,000 people and gained 500 organic likes), boosted employee thought‑leadership, and drove campaign impact (#resilientcities saw 3,000 mentions, a 10–20% share of voice, and 7,000 tracked Twitter referrals), shifting success measures from mere impressions to real influence.
